Topographical Characteristics of Frequent Inundation Areas In Tangerang City, Indonesia

Abstract

Topographical characteristic, meteorological characteristics, and artificial characteristics (human activities) cause flooding in urban areas. Jakarta rapid development gives an urbanization impact to its suburbs. Accordingly, Tangerang city, as a suburban area of Jakarta, facing that effect. The proposed methodology in this research is based on GIS computation of the frequent inundation areas in Tangerang between 2008 and 2015. We extracted its topographical characteristics and analyzed it to find a correlation between topographical elements and frequent inundation areas. Thus, we applied its topographical element score for all mesh across the city. As a result 78. % of Tangerang city area is classified as high-risk topographical inundation, then only 54. % of the frequently inundated areas and 85. % of ordinary inundated areas are considered to be in high-risk zone. The result indicates that topographical characteristic alone is not sufficient to explain the emerging of an inundation area.
